About the role

Fanatics is building a leading global digital sports platform. We ignite the passions of global sports fans and maximize the presence and reach for our hundreds of sports partners globally by offering products and services across Fanatics Commerce, Fanatics Collectibles, and Fanatics Betting & Gaming, allowing sports fans to Buy, Collect, and Bet. Through the Fanatics platform, sports fans can buy licensed fan gear, jerseys, lifestyle and streetwear products, headwear, and hardgoods; collect physical and digital trading cards, sports memorabilia, and other digital assets; and bet as the company builds its Sportsbook and iGaming platform. Fanatics has an established database of over 100 million global sports fans; a global partner network with approximately 900 sports properties, including major national and international professional sports leagues, players associations, teams, colleges, college conferences and retail partners, 2,500 athletes and celebrities, and 200 exclusive athletes; and over 2,000 retail locations, including its Lids retail stores. Our more than 22,000 employees are committed to relentlessly enhancing the fan experience and delighting sports fans globally. Engineering Manager Fanatics Markets is the real-money prediction and trading app where you can invest in moments you care about. Built on a secure platform, we let users predict real-world outcomes and trade on events they actually follow, from sports and entertainment to political elections and beyond. Our mission is to redefine how fans engage with the moments and markets that matter most. We're looking for the right people to help us build the future of prediction markets. We are looking for an Engineering Manager to lead our core FMX trading team. You will own the delivery, culture, and growth of your team as we build a regulated trading platform from scratch, managing a group of 5 to 8 engineers. This is a hands-on leadership role: you will be deeply involved in technical direction while fostering a culture of innovation and continuous improvement. You will partner closely with FMX leadership, compliance, and our existing Fanatics Markets web engineering organisation to establish ways of working that can support 24/7 trading operations. We're pioneering the use of AI as a code collaborator across all of engineering. We need leaders who actively champion AI-assisted development, helping their teams adopt tools like Claude Code, Cursor, or GitHub Copilot to maximise delivery velocity without compromising quality or regulatory compliance.

Responsibilities

  • Lead your team in exploring and applying new technologies and practices, cultivating a culture of innovation and continuous improvement to deliver a world-class regulated trading platform.
  • Collaborate closely with Product, Compliance, and other engineering leaders to develop cohesive solutions aligned with FMX strategic objectives and regulatory obligations.
  • Use data and metrics to guide your team's decision-making, tracking delivery velocity, reliability SLOs, and compliance posture as core team health indicators.
  • Champion a metrics-driven culture focused on measurable impact, from system uptime and latency to audit trail completeness and daily reporting accuracy.
  • Invest in the growth and success of your team, offer mentorship, support career development, and help shape the next generation of engineering leaders within FMX.
  • Oversee the development of scalable, reliable systems while driving modernisation of the Java codebase and new development in Go, Java and Kotlin.
  • Own engineering processes appropriate for a 24/7 regulated trading environment, sprint planning, on-call rotations, incident response, code review standards, and change management.
  • Build strong cross-functional partnerships with legal, compliance, and the wider Fanatics engineering organisation to influence technical and product direction.
  • Communicate complex technical concepts and regulatory requirements with clarity and confidence to stakeholders at all levels, including executive leadership.
  • Champion the use of AI-assisted development tools across your team, setting the standard for responsible adoption that meets regulated-environment quality and security requirements.
  • Stay on top of industry trends in regulated trading infrastructure and prediction markets, bringing fresh ideas that elevate team performance.
  • Be open to occasional travel for offsites, cross-team collaboration, or regulatory engagements.
